Does it look like this one?

Unfortuntely the data on VeloBase on this model is incomplete in respects to chain wrap. 28T sounds like a reasonable guess for the chain wrap on these though.
List of all suntour rear derailleurs on velobase can be seen here:
http://velobase.com/SearchVisual_Lis...l_Category=108